Welcome to the forum! Take some time to learn about flatheads, it's worth the trouble! They are really very simple, very reliable unless abused. Time spent up-front (before trying to use it regularly) to verify everything is in decent shape will pay big dividends. Personally I think the small amount of time it takes to pull the intake manifold to see the amount of junk that's in the valve chest, and dropping the pan to clean the sludge out of there, are well worth the time it takes. (It's EASY!)
